Abstract

The utility model discloses a kind of protective shielding door, and the upper edge of the shielding door body sets rack;Also include fixed motor and movable rotation fastener;The output shaft of the motor is coaxially connected with gear, and the gear coordinates with the rack;When the motor rotates, its output shaft drives the pinion rotation and makes the shielding door body reach close or move afterwards and open;The movable rotation fastener includes liftable wheel shaft, and fixed cover is provided with involute shape gear on the wheel shaft, and the involute shape gear coordinates with the rack;When the shielding door body reach is closed, the involute gear is engaged with the rack and rotated forward by the rack drives, and pressure is supported gradually to be imposed to the rack;When moving opening after the shielding door body, the involute gear is engaged with the rack and rotated backward by the rack drives, and the involute gear fades away to the pressure of supporting of the rack.

Embodiment
The utility model is described in further detail below in conjunction with the accompanying drawings, to make those skilled in the art with reference to explanation Book word can be implemented according to this.
As shown in figure 1, protective shielding door described in the utility model, including guide groove 2 and supported by the guide groove 2 Door body 1 is shielded, the lower edge of the shielding door body 1 is provided with multiple support guide wheels 11, the support guide wheel 11 is described Moved in guide groove 2 and support the shielding door body 1 to close or open along the guide groove 2.
In order to make the work of shielding door body 1 relatively reliable, prevent from occurring in the state of shielding door body 1 has been switched off Non-artificial to open by mistake and (loosen and disengage), the utility model is fixedly installed rack 12 on the upper edge of the shielding door body 1.With Corresponding to, fixed motor 3 and movable rotation fastener 4 are additionally provided with the top of the shielding door body 1 (motor 3 and movable rotation fastener 4 can be installed in the doorframe on shielding door body 1 top).
As shown in figure 1, the output shaft 31 of the motor 3 is coaxially connected with gear 32, the gear 32 and the tooth Bar 12 coordinates;When the motor 3 rotates, its output shaft 31 drives the gear 32 to rotate and make the shielding door body 1 reach is closed or rear move is opened.The movable rotation fastener 4 includes liftable wheel shaft 41, on the wheel shaft 41 Fixed cover is provided with involute shape gear 42, and the involute shape gear 42 coordinates with the rack 12.When the shielding door body 1 When reach is closed, the involute gear 42 engages with the rack 12 and is driven and rotated forward by the rack 12, with right The rack 12, which gradually imposes, to be supported pressure (i.e. involute gear at initial stage 42 and the rack 12 coordinates but not to rack 12 Impose and support pressure, with the reach of shielding door body 1, rack 12 can drive the involute gear 42 to synchronize rotation, Again because it is involute-type, therefore its teeth can gradually compress rack 12, namely rack 12 is gradually imposed and supports pressure, so as to Effectively prevent from shielding door body 1 in the state of having been switched off again by non-artificial opening by mistake).Moved after the shielding door body 1 During opening, the involute gear 42 engages with the rack 12 and is driven and rotated backward by the rack 12, described gradually to open Line gear 42 to the rack 12 support pressure fade away (this process with it is foregoing gradually compaction process on the contrary, not going to live in the household of one's in-laws on getting married herein Chat).
In the utility model, the movable rotation fastener 4 also includes two pieces of fixed supported slabs 43 being oppositely arranged, Offer vertical elongated hole 431 on the fixed supported slab 43, the both ends of the wheel shaft 41 be fed through respectively the vertical elongated hole 431, And it can be moved up and down along the vertical elongated hole 431;Also include the top spring 432 for being respectively arranged at two pieces of outsides of fixed supported slab 43, institute State top spring 432 wheel shaft 41 is imposed and downward support power.In the utility model, the involute gear 42 on the wheel shaft 41 To rack 12 support pressure it is ensured that effectively prevent from shielding door body 1 not the non-artificial factor of reason and open by mistake and open, meanwhile, and not The normal reach of shielding door body 1 can be hindered, which to close, (if wheel shaft 41 can not move up, then can directly affect shielding door body 1 Normal switching-off).Therefore, the top spring 432 of setting is especially necessary.The top spring 432 of appropriate size can be specifically selected according to field condition.
In the utility model, the pressure of supporting to rack 12 is lost in order to prevent involute gear 42 from loosening, also enters one Step is provided with the elastic push rod 5 for being used for fixing the teeth that involute shape gear 42 is stated in residence.The free end quilt of the elastic push rod 5 Stiff spring 52 draws and is resisted against the teeth of the involute gear 42;The opposite face of the stiff spring 52 is provided with drawing Line 51, when the bracing wire 51 is pulled by external force, the free end of the elastic push rod 5 is pulled up and departs from the involute gear 42 teeth.That is, as shown in figure 1, when shielding the reach closing of door body 1, the involute gear 42 is in inverse The state that hour hands rotate, then, although elastic push rod 5 is resisted against the teeth of the involute gear 42, and without prejudice to gradually opening Line gear 42 rotates counterclockwise, that is, does not influence involute gear 42 and impose rack 12 to support pressure;On the contrary, ought gradually it open When line gear 42 is intended to rotate clockwise (i.e. the involute gear 42 no longer imposes to rack supports pressure), it is necessary to pass through bracing wire 51 pull elastic push rod 5, disengage it from the teeth of involute gear 42, in order to which involute gear 42 is able to turn clockwise It is dynamic.
In the utility model, it is also a housing for shielding the accommodating chamber 6 of door body 1;The accommodating chamber 6 is recessed in wall Inside, the side of the accommodating chamber 6 have the opening 61 passed in and out for the shielding door body 1;The guide groove 2 extend into institute along ground State in accommodating chamber 6.Further, in order to maintain shield door body 1 pass in and out accommodating chamber balance, also it is described opening 61 both sides Support runner 62 is arranged oppositely, and the support runner 62 of the both sides supports two sides that shielding door body 1 is stated in residence respectively Face 13.
In protective shielding door described in the utility model, by setting movable rotation fastener so that with The reach for shielding door body is closed, and the shielding door body can gradually be applied pressures below, so as to make the shielding door body not miss Open, so as to actually reach the effect of security protection.
